Peaty's LinkLube chain oil series has arrived.
Peaty's LinkLube offers four types of chain oil to choose from, depending on the weather and usage conditions.
LinkLube DRY

A biodegradable, wax-based dry condition oil for sunny and dry conditions. It evaporates after application, coating the chain with wax. This keeps dirt and dust from sticking and maintains a clean drivetrain. You can easily apply a wax coat without needing troublesome pre-treatment.
LinkLube WET

A wet condition oil that performs optimally in rainy, wet, and muddy conditions. It features a proprietary biodegradable base oil blended with wax and powerful corrosion inhibitors. It is less prone to running out of oil, even in downhill and cyclocross races held in bad weather, offering excellent durability and longevity. Also recommended for e-bikes, which put more stress on the drivetrain.
LinkLube ALLWEATHER

Peaty's most basic oil, blending a proprietary base oil with wax. This all-condition type handles a variety of situations, such as sunny and dry days, rainy days, muddy conditions, or a mix of these. It also has a self-cleaning function, flushing out dirt from inside the chain links and maintaining smooth lubrication.
LinkLube PREMIUM ALLWEATHER

A premium all-condition lube that improves LinkLube ALLWEATHER's durability by 30%.
